ABSTRACT:
An improved rotary rock bit having a circumferential row of wear resistant inserts protruding from the gage surface of each rolling cone cutter. The inserts are designed to efficiently break and remove earth formations. Adequate clearance is provided around the gage inserts for chip formation, chip removal, and insert cooling. These rows of inserts provide reaming action to maintain borehole gage diameter after the primary gage cutting structure has worn or failed.
